Walmart Apparel Liquidations Drive Growth of Bin Stores

Walmart apparel liquidations have become a major catalyst in the expansion of bin stores, fueling growth in the secondary retail market and providing entrepreneurs with access to affordable, brand-name clothing. By redistributing overstock, seasonal items, and customer returns, Walmart ensures that excess merchandise continues to circulate, enabling small businesses and resale operations to thrive in competitive markets.

Bin stores, also known as discount or bulk-outlet stores, specialize in offering low-cost products to value-conscious shoppers. Walmart apparel liquidations provide these stores with a steady supply of high-quality clothing for men, women, and children, including casual wear, activewear, outerwear, and accessories. Many of these items are brand-name and in excellent condition, giving bin stores a competitive edge by allowing them to offer products that appeal to a wide range of customers.

One of the primary advantages of Walmart apparel liquidations is affordability. By purchasing clothing at a fraction of the original retail price, bin store owners can maintain strong profit margins while offering customers attractive prices. This pricing flexibility is essential for small retailers seeking to compete with larger chains and appeal to bargain-minded shoppers.

Variety is another significant benefit. Liquidation lots often include multiple sizes, styles, and seasonal items, allowing bin stores to provide diverse inventory that meets different customer needs. From trendy seasonal apparel to essential wardrobe staples, this variety ensures shoppers consistently find new and desirable products, encouraging repeat visits and customer loyalty.

Operational efficiency is also enhanced through Walmart liquidations. Bulk purchases simplify sourcing and inventory management while reducing per-unit costs. Bin store owners can replenish stock quickly, maintain rapid turnover, and respond to changing market trends without the delays associated with traditional wholesale supply chains.

Sustainability is an additional advantage of utilizing liquidated apparel. By redirecting overstock and returned merchandise into resale channels, Walmart helps reduce waste and supports environmentally responsible practices. Products that might otherwise go unused are given a second life, appealing to consumers who value eco-conscious shopping options.

The growth of bin stores fueled by Walmart apparel liquidations has also contributed to entrepreneurship in local communities. Small business owners can leverage liquidation inventory to expand product offerings, establish a loyal customer base, and compete effectively in both physical and online retail markets. The accessibility and affordability of these liquidations make it possible for new businesses to enter the resale industry and scale operations efficiently.
